You are not logged in.

#1 2020-03-29 13:11:49

Ekaradon
Member
Registered: 2014-05-31
Posts: 44

[Optimus] Plasma stop showing panel when switching to Nvidia driver

Hello,

I have installed and setup (or so I thought) `optimus-manager` and its applet (optimus-manager-qt). When I use it in order to go to the nvidia setup, I have to login again and... it works except that my panels have disappeared. And when I try to add one, it looks like it does nothing. However when I login again to KDE with Intel setup, I see now the new panel I have added.
i97wdVw.png
So I have been looking for relevant logs about this problem but I see only irrelevant logs complaining about `qt.qpa.xcb: QXcbConnection: XCB error: 3 (BadWindow)` for example.
Is there someone here having any idea about what happening? What could I investigate in order to understand the problem?

Thanks!

Offline

#2 2020-03-29 13:19:45

V1del
Forum Moderator
Registered: 2012-10-16
Posts: 21,659

Re: [Optimus] Plasma stop showing panel when switching to Nvidia driver

How do you start plasma? That sounds like you aren't properly logged out.

Offline

#3 2020-03-29 13:23:12

Ekaradon
Member
Registered: 2014-05-31
Posts: 44

Re: [Optimus] Plasma stop showing panel when switching to Nvidia driver

Through SDDM. The applet (optimus-manager-qt) is killing my current session and I just have to login again.

Offline

#4 2020-03-29 13:29:43

V1del
Forum Moderator
Registered: 2012-10-16
Posts: 21,659

Re: [Optimus] Plasma stop showing panel when switching to Nvidia driver

systemctl status

from the nvidia session? You might have to set up: https://wiki.archlinux.org/index.php/Sy … _on_logout or at the very least adjust UserStopDelaySec= .  If you wait for at least 10 secs before relogging, does it work properly?

Last edited by V1del (2020-03-29 13:35:01)

Offline

#5 2020-03-29 13:49:58

Ekaradon
Member
Registered: 2014-05-31
Posts: 44

Re: [Optimus] Plasma stop showing panel when switching to Nvidia driver

I have tried with the following configuration `KillUserProcesses=yes` but it did not change anything. Here a copy from the systemctl status with nvidia session:

    State: running
     Jobs: 0 queued
   Failed: 0 units
    Since: Sun 2020-03-29 15:44:43 CEST; 3min 54s ago
   CGroup: /
           ├─user.slice 
           │ └─user-1000.slice 
           │   ├─user@1000.service 
           │   │ ├─pulseaudio.service 
           │   │ │ ├─2928 /usr/bin/pulseaudio --daemonize=no
           │   │ │ └─2979 /usr/lib/pulse/gsettings-helper
           │   │ ├─init.scope 
           │   │ │ ├─2801 /usr/lib/systemd/systemd --user
           │   │ │ └─2802 (sd-pam)
           │   │ ├─obex.service 
           │   │ │ └─3245 /usr/lib/bluetooth/obexd
           │   │ ├─at-spi-dbus-bus.service 
           │   │ │ └─3060 /usr/lib/at-spi-bus-launcher
           │   │ └─dbus.service 
           │   │   ├─2819 /usr/bin/dbus-daemon --session --address=systemd: --nofork --nopidfile --systemd-activation --syslog-only
           │   │   ├─2858 /usr/lib/dconf-service
           │   │   ├─2878 /usr/bin/kglobalaccel5
           │   │   ├─2893 /usr/lib/kactivitymanagerd
           │   │   └─2902 /usr/lib/kf5/kscreen_backend_launcher
           │   └─session-5.scope 
           │     ├─2797 /usr/lib/sddm/sddm-helper --socket /tmp/sddm-authe113667f-0b54-4d1a-bd27-25531f0fdddf --id 3 --start /usr/bin/startplasma-x11 --user ekaradon
           │     ├─2813 /usr/bin/kwalletd5 --pam-login 7 3
           │     ├─2814 /usr/bin/startplasma-x11
           │     ├─2829 /usr/lib/kf5/start_kdeinit --kded +kcminit_startup
           │     ├─2830 kdeinit5: Running...
           │     ├─2832 /usr/lib/kf5/klauncher --fd=9
           │     ├─2836 kded5
           │     ├─2849 /usr/bin/kaccess
           │     ├─2851 /usr/bin/plasma_session
           │     ├─2867 /usr/bin/ksmserver
           │     ├─2903 /usr/bin/kwin_x11 -session 10c8fdea84000157000044600000011160011_1585489513_751519
           │     ├─2905 /usr/bin/plasmashell
           │     ├─2911 /usr/lib/polkit-kde-authentication-agent-1
           │     ├─2914 /usr/bin/xembedsniproxy
           │     ├─2920 /usr/bin/gmenudbusmenuproxy
           │     ├─2925 /usr/lib/kdeconnectd
           │     ├─2927 /usr/lib/DiscoverNotifier -session 10c8fdea84000158548949900000011790006_1585489513_722603
           │     ├─2941 /usr/bin/kwalletmanager5 -session 10c8fdea84000158547929100000013620007_1585489513_722718
           │     ├─2958 /usr/lib/firefox/firefox --sm-client-id 10c8fdea84000158512859500000011550014
           │     ├─2997 /usr/bin/konsole -session 10c8fdea84000158515284200000011550016_1585489513_722919
           │     ├─3047 /usr/bin/optimus-manager-qt -session 10c8fdea84000158547851900000012400011_1585489513_750378
           │     ├─3063 /usr/lib/org_kde_powerdevil
           │     ├─3072 /usr/bin/zsh
           │     ├─3112 ssh-agent -s
           │     ├─3148 /usr/lib/firefox/firefox -contentproc -childID 1 -isForBrowser -prefsLen 1 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true tab
           │     ├─3215 /usr/lib/firefox/firefox -contentproc -childID 2 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3221 /usr/lib/firefox/firefox -contentproc -childID 3 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3227 /usr/lib/firefox/firefox -contentproc -childID 4 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3244 /usr/lib/firefox/firefox -contentproc -childID 5 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3276 /usr/lib/firefox/firefox -contentproc -childID 6 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3306 /usr/lib/firefox/firefox -contentproc -childID 7 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3326 /usr/lib/firefox/firefox -contentproc -childID 8 -isForBrowser -prefsLen 494 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true >
           │     ├─3347 /usr/lib/kf5/kio_http_cache_cleaner
           │     ├─3466 /usr/lib/firefox/firefox -contentproc -childID 9 -isForBrowser -prefsLen 6586 -prefMapSize 223490 -parentBuildID 20200310120528 -greomni /usr/lib/firefox/omni.ja -appomni /usr/lib/firefox/browser/omni.ja -appdir /usr/lib/firefox/browser 2958 true>
           │     ├─3522 /usr/bin/plasma-browser-integration-host /usr/lib/mozilla/native-messaging-hosts/org.kde.plasma.browser_integration.json plasma-browser-integration@kde.org
           │     ├─4497 file.so [kdeinit5] file local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/kded5WtAnbL.2.slave-socket
           │     ├─5351 /usr/bin/krunner
           │     ├─5392 tags.so [kdeinit5] tags local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/krunnermCwxlH.1.slave-socket
           │     ├─5406 /usr/bin/dolphin
           │     ├─5411 tags.so [kdeinit5] tags local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insdFqIp.1.slave-socket
           │     ├─5412 trash.so [kdeinit5] trash local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inSQUBPO.2.slave-socket
           │     ├─5413 file.so [kdeinit5] file local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infTJdwo.3.slave-socket
           │     ├─5415 file.so [kdeinit5] file local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inZhhoXd.4.slave-socket
           │     ├─5416 file.so [kdeinit5] file local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inqXQQth.5.slave-socket
           │     ├─5417 thumbnail.so [kdeinit5] thumbnail local:/run/user/1000/klauncherxcyZRM.1.slave-socket local:/run/user/1000/dolphinHEMsQv.7.slave-socket
           │     ├─5493 /usr/bin/kwrite /home/ekaradon/Documents/systemctl-status.txt
           │     ├─6330 systemctl status
           │     └─6331 less
           ├─init.scope 
           │ └─1 /sbin/init
           └─system.slice 
             ├─packagekit.service 
             │ └─1256 /usr/lib/PackageKit/packagekitd
             ├─systemd-udevd.service 
             │ └─321 /usr/lib/systemd/systemd-udevd
             ├─systemd-homed.service 
             │ └─499 /usr/lib/systemd/systemd-homed
             ├─docker.service 
             │ ├─755 /usr/bin/dockerd -H fd://
             │ └─767 containerd --config /var/run/docker/containerd/containerd.toml --log-level info
             ├─polkit.service 
             │ └─784 /usr/lib/polkit-1/polkitd --no-debug
             ├─rtkit-daemon.service 
             │ └─1248 /usr/lib/rtkit-daemon
             ├─bluetooth.service 
             │ └─584 /usr/lib/bluetooth/bluetoothd
             ├─wpa_supplicant.service 
             │ └─652 /usr/bin/wpa_supplicant -u -s -O /run/wpa_supplicant
             ├─systemd-journald.service 
             │ └─306 /usr/lib/systemd/systemd-journald
             ├─colord.service 
             │ └─568 /usr/lib/colord
             ├─org.cups.cupsd.service 
             │ └─529 /usr/bin/cupsd -l
             ├─NetworkManager.service 
             │ └─494 /usr/bin/NetworkManager --no-daemon
             ├─systemd-userdbd.service 
             │ ├─727 /usr/lib/systemd/systemd-userdbd
             │ ├─728 systemd-userwork
             │ ├─729 systemd-userwork
             │ └─730 systemd-userwork
             ├─systemd-swap.service 
             │ ├─ 559 /bin/bash /usr/bin/systemd-swap start
             │ └─6329 sleep 1s
             ├─cups-browsed.service 
             │ └─608 /usr/bin/cups-browsed
             ├─lvm2-lvmetad.service 
             │ └─312 /usr/bin/lvmetad -f
             ├─upower.service 
             │ └─821 /usr/lib/upowerd
             ├─sddm.service 
             │ ├─ 656 /usr/bin/sddm
             │ └─2687 /usr/lib/Xorg -nolisten tcp -auth /var/run/sddm/{a8749751-6e15-46f1-b48f-4e8bb87ed904} -background none -noreset -displayfd 18 -seat seat0 vt1
             ├─udisks2.service 
             │ └─773 /usr/lib/udisks2/udisksd
             ├─dbus.service 
             │ └─492 /usr/bin/dbus-daemon --system --address=systemd: --nofork --nopidfile --systemd-activation --syslog-only
             ├─systemd-timesyncd.service 
             │ └─474 /usr/lib/systemd/systemd-timesyncd
             ├─optimus-manager.service 
             │ └─650 /usr/bin/python3 -u /usr/bin/optimus-manager-daemon
             ├─avahi-daemon.service 
             │ ├─491 avahi-daemon: running [COMWATT-DZI.local]
             │ └─506 avahi-daemon: chroot helper
             └─systemd-logind.service 
               └─502 /usr/lib/systemd/systemd-logind

Offline

Board footer

Powered by FluxBB